History of Violence, author: Edouard Louis

 Audio book in English

History of Violence, author: Edouard Louis








 




V explicite, a portrait of a northern France small town violence.

How the mother had to suffer so much to get the small amt of income, how the immigrant workers from North Africa have to slave all their lives housed in small rooms, 4 at a time, the noise, the smell, the celibacy of all these men doing a low end physical labour, all told from a v calm, detailed voice.  Himself looking at himself in a detached way but not forgetting any details that could render the story with sharpness and understanding.  Misunderstandings, the missed communications, the homosexual acts from meeting to action to stealing objects to fear, to going to the police, the hospitals.  How the police made him repeat time and time again, changing bureaus, in order to establish a "file", which maybe useful as a "profile" maybe so they could take acct of what happened.  The racism, this racism is overtly pointed to Arabs, but aren't the low end little folks the same, same as poor immigrant workers?  They are of the same soup so to speak.  V well written. V courageous.  Reading this book is like taking me to the scene from all angles at once.  No film, no real person could actually have done that without the writers voice and eyes, from the inside out.  

Only writing a novel in such multiple angles could the 3D-ness of the events, in time, in history, in geophysical happenings could this be told.
